WebGlossary. Acute exacerbation: An episode of rapid worsening of a pulmonary (relating to lungs) condition.. Alveoli: Tiny air sacs in the lungs where carbon dioxide leaves the bloodstream and oxygen enters the bloodstream.. WebLysosomal storage diseases (LSDs) cause a toxic buildup that damages your body’s cells and organs. Researchers have found more than 70 types of LSDs. Providers usually diagnose LSDs during pregnancy or infancy. Diagnosis includes blood and urine tests.
